Muscat Municipality to close all commercial shops in Muscat governorate starting March 23, 2020

The Muscat Municipality has issued a decision to close all shops within the Governorate of Muscat, starting from the date of today, 23 March 2020 until further notice to prevent the spread of coronavirus.

However, the municipality stated that the decision excludes the following stores:

  1. Food and consumer catering stores.
  2. Clinics, pharmacies and optical stores.
  3. Restaurants and cafes outside malls (but ordering and delivery services only).
  4. Gas stations.
